Output 89089cadf91c91e24f7398c811c25591798f35277bd7dac2703abf406d76eb2d:36

value
10149
script pubkey
OP_0 OP_PUSHBYTES_20 52bdd6e7920d4c635bb04baa51a064dd2baea086
address
bc1q227adeujp4xxxkasfw49rgrym546agyxqlczg8
transaction
89089cadf91c91e24f7398c811c25591798f35277bd7dac2703abf406d76eb2d